Young winger heads out on loan...

EMERGING winger, Kieron Morris, has today linked up with Conference North outfit, Leamington on loan until January 14th 2014.

The youth team product was handed his first professional contract during the summer of 2012 and last term had a spell out on loan at Worcester City.

Handed a new deal at the start of the current campaign, he has been a regular for the reserves, where his pace and skill has served us well.

“We’ve not got a lot of reserve team games between now and January,” admitted manager, Dean Smith. “This is the opportunity for him to go out and play regular, competitive football at a decent level.

“He wants game time and having sent Jake Heath out on loan to Leamington this season, I know at first-hand that they are a club who look to do things the right way and play good football.

“This move will help his development.”

Morris is relishing the opportunity to get some matches under his belt. “This time of the year is always busy, with the games coming thick and fast,” he added. “I’m looking forward to the chance to play regularly and show the Gaffer what I can do.

“I know that the club will monitor my progress very closely, so it’s an opportunity to really stake my claims for a first-team place here.”
